
qq:800819103
在线客服,实时响应
联系方式:
13318873961

一、Unix系统代理IP软件概述
Unix系统下的代理IP软件核心是指为Unix操作系统设计的专门用于代理网络请求的软件。这些软件能够帮助用户在Unix环境下实现HTTP代理功能,节约网络访问速度平静安性。
二、HTTP代理基本概念
HTTP代理,即超文本传输协议代理,是一种网络代理服务。它允许客户端通过代理ip软件 unix发送请求,代理ip软件 unix再将请求转发给目标服务器,并将响应返回给客户端。HTTP代理在节约网络访问速度、保护用户隐私和网络平安等方面具有重要作用。
三、Unix系统下常见的HTTP代理软件
1. Squid
Squid是一款高性能的代理ip软件 unix软件,适用于Unix、Linux、Windows等多种操作系统。它拥护HTTP、HTTPS、FTP等多种协议,具有缓存功能,可以有效节约网络访问速度。
2. Proxychains
Proxychains是一款Unix系统下的代理链路管理工具,可以将多个代理ip软件 unix串联起来,实现更复杂化的代理需求。它拥护HTTP、SOCKS、SSL等多种协议,并具有丰盈的配置选项。
3. Privoxy
Privoxy是一款轻量级的代理服务器软件,适用于Unix、Linux、Windows等多种操作系统。它具有缓存功能,可以过滤广告和恶意代码,保护用户隐私。
四、Unix系统下HTTP代理软件的配置方法
1. Squid配置
(1)安装Squid软件
在Unix系统中,可以使用包管理器安装Squid软件。例如,在Debian/Ubuntu系统中,可以使用以下命令安装
sudo aptget install squid
(2)配置Squid
编辑Squid的配置文件`/etc/squid/squid.conf`,进行以下配置
http_port 3128
cache_dir ufs /var/spool/squid 100 16 256
(3)启动Squid服务
使用以下命令启动Squid服务
sudo systemctl start squid
2. Proxychains配置
(1)安装Proxychains
在Unix系统中,可以使用包管理器安装Proxychains软件。例如,在Debian/Ubuntu系统中,可以使用以下命令安装
sudo aptget install proxychains
(2)配置Proxychains
编辑Proxychains的配置文件`/etc/proxychains.conf`,添加代理服务器地址和端口
socks4 192.168.1.1 1080
(3)启动Proxychains
使用以下命令启动Proxychains
proxychains4 <命令>
3. Privoxy配置
(1)安装Privoxy
在Unix系统中,可以使用包管理器安装Privoxy软件。例如,在Debian/Ubuntu系统中,可以使用以下命令安装
sudo aptget install privoxy
(2)配置Privoxy
编辑Privoxy的配置文件`/etc/privoxy/config`,进行以下配置
forwardsocks4 / 192.168.1.1 1080 .
(3)启动Privoxy服务
使用以下命令启动Privoxy服务
sudo systemctl start privoxy
五、Unix系统下HTTP代理软件的使用技巧
1. 使用代理浏览器插件
许多浏览器插件可以方便地管理HTTP代理设置,例如Firefox的Proxy SwitchyOmega插件。
2. 使用SSH隧道
通过SSH隧道,可以将Unix系统上的HTTP代理服务扩展到其他设备。
3. 使用命令行工具
使用命令行工具,如curl,可以方便地设置HTTP代理。
六、总结
Unix系统下的代理IP软件在节约网络访问速度、保护用户隐私和网络平安等方面具有重要作用。本文详细介绍了Unix系统下常见的HTTP代理软件及其配置方法,为用户提供了实用的参考。在实际应用中,用户可以依自己的需求选择合适的代理软件,并掌握相应的配置技巧。